Refrigerated Containers
Refrigerated Containers (also known as reefers) are used by a variety of industries to transport temperature-sensitive products over long distances. From catering companies delivering ready-to-eat meals to research labs transporting blood plasma, a refrigerated container can be customized with features such as remote monitoring and backup power options.
A shipping container that is refrigerated will ensure that your items arrive in excellent condition. Energy efficiency is a key aspect for modern refrigeration units, as is high-quality insulation.
Customization
Every decision you make when it comes to refrigerated container security and integrity plays a role. Your discerning choices will ensure that your goods remain in top condition by making sure you select the appropriate size for different types of shipments, and advanced features to improve the management of cold chains.
For instance, choosing a container that is sized to the volume of your product reduces temperature fluctuations and increases efficiency of energy. The type of insulation you choose is crucial as well. Foam and vacuum insulation panels are both available, but picking the right one depends on your individual requirements. Foam is more affordable and vacuum offers superior thermal resistance.
In the world of reefer technology, leveraging IoT capabilities, you can have continuous monitoring and alerts to ensure your shipment is protected throughout its journey. Digital advancements also improve efficiency in operations and supply chain visibility.
If it's for live cargo or pharmaceuticals, a specialized refrigeration unit will be designed to meet your individual requirements and ensure the safety of your products during long journeys. These containers can be equipped with redundancy systems to prevent any unexpected system malfunctions. They could be fitted with materials that meet the high standards of the pharmaceutical sector or ensure a safe and healthy environment for transit for livestock.
Other innovations include airflow vents and fresh air ducts that manage the inside environment and ensure it is steady. These piping systems can remove gases like ethylene which speeds up the process of ripening in fruits, and they ensure even distribution of temperatures across the entire container. Additionally the built-in drainage system helps prevent the accumulation of water and the spread of insects.
Energy Efficiency
Refrigerated Containers provide a secure and safe place to store temperature-sensitive cargo. They can protect pharmaceuticals and premium food items. They are made with advanced control systems and top-quality insulation to ensure that internal temperatures remain steady. They also offer advanced security features that help ensure your products are safe from theft and vandalism. Some containers are designed to be environmentally sustainable and use renewable sources of energy, making them a viable option for companies.
Refrigeration systems are essential for maintaining the quality of cargo, however they can also consume a lot energy. This is especially relevant when there are a lot of containers that are stored on the same container vessel or at a terminal. This high electricity consumption can be reduced by using refrigerated containers with automated temperature control systems. These systems are designed to monitor and adjust the temperature of the container based on its surroundings and result in significant energy savings.
Modern refrigerated containers (reefers) that are designed to be energy efficient, utilize advanced cooling and insulation technology to reduce power consumption. Diesel generators are often included in these containers, to ensure that they can be used even when there is no power source. This enables them to operate in transit or even when stationary power is not available.
The heat exchange between the container interior and the outside environment is responsible for a significant portion of the energy consumption in refrigerated containers. This exchange of heat occurs through cold-resistant insulation. Its proportion ranges from 35 to 85% during cooling and can reach 50 % when heating (Filina and Filin, 2004).
The following measures are recommended to reduce the energy consumption of refrigerated containers. They include adaptation of the layout of the terminal and the use of electrical handling equipment as well as the search for energy-saving operating modes of refrigerated containers with frozen or chilled cargo, and integration of cranes and trucks scheduling (Yang and Lin 2013). It is important to remember that the reduction in ( Overset bullet Q _1 ) component share will result in proportional reduction in the total electricity consumption. As part of their innovative and energy-saving strategies, small seaports and container terminals are encouraged to implement the measures proposed.
Security
Refrigerated containers are built with security features that keep your goods safe from being tampered with. The container's strong design can withstand temperature fluctuations and environmental damage, while the door locks are integrated to block unwanted entry. The refrigeration systems are totally isolated from the rest of the container, ensuring that any alteration to the system or malfunction won't alter the temperature. The units can also be fitted with temperature alarms that notify you of any problems in real-time.
Many industries rely on refrigerated containers for the transportation of their products. From catering companies that ship prepared meals to research laboratories that transport sensitive samples, refrigerated containers provide reliable, temperature-controlled transportation. In addition to safeguarding the quality of the products, refrigerated containers help businesses reduce waste and maintain regulatory compliance. In industries that deal with perishable products, spoilage and waste are the most significant problems. Spoilage is not just a source of financial losses, but it could also pose a threat to the security of consumers. With advanced temperature control refrigerated containers can maintain the integrity of products, thus extending their shelf time and allowing them to be used for longer.
Insulation of the highest quality in refrigerated containers keeps the interior temperature steady, allowing precise control over the temperature of the environment. Modern reefer containers offer different cooling options, ranging from chilled to subzero freezing. This lets you adjust the temperature to meet your individual requirements and ensure that your items are in top condition.
The premium refrigerated container also features advanced air circulation systems that ensure a constant temperature throughout the cargo area. They are equipped with fans that distribute the cold air evenly, preventing hot spots and deliver superior ventilation. The units are also fitted with humidity control, ensuring that your food items remain fresh and free from deterioration. The control of humidity is crucial for fruits and vegetables that continue to generate heat and create ethylene after harvesting. Additionally, the ventilation system is designed to remove these gases from the container.
Refrigerated containers play a vital role in international trade. They enable businesses to reach customers all over the globe, without losing quality of the product. Maintenance
Refrigerated Containers are a great way to transport temperature-sensitive cargo, but they require proper maintenance and cleaning to ensure optimal performance. Routine calibration, power maintenance, and insulation maintenance are among the best ways to maintain the refrigerated container in good order.
Temperature Monitoring
Refrigerated containers can be monitored remotely to ensure that the temperature within stays within a specific range. This feature provides logistics professionals with complete records of data for quality control. Special reefer containers also come with backup power sources to ensure that temperature control systems are not affected due to power outages.
Cooling
Airflow systems are used in refrigerators to distribute cold air throughout the container, ensuring that the cargo at the optimal temperature. This helps eliminate moisture, gases, and ethylene that are produced by vegetables and fruits, which can lead to spoilage.
It is essential to check the insulated piping of reefers for leakage. Using an halide and soap lamp or electronic leak detector will assist in determining the source of any issues. It is also an excellent idea to inspect the inside of the refrigerator unit on a regular basis for any ice accumulation. This could affect the capacity of the container's cooling.
Compressors are an essential component in the cooling process. 20ft Shipping Containers are responsible for pressingurizing the refrigerant, and circulating it through the refrigeration system. Regular calibrations of the compressor can increase efficiency and decrease energy consumption.
Insulation is a crucial component of special reefer containers because it reduces the heat exchange between interior and exterior. High-quality insulation materials like polyurethane foam are used to maximize efficiency in thermal efficiency and ensure consistent temperatures throughout the entire shipping journey.
The final step to ensure the integrity of a refrigerated container is to clean it regularly. This involves cleaning the interior of the container and wiping the surfaces. This is especially important for areas that could affect the seals of doors, such as underneath and behind them.
It is also recommended to paint the exterior of a refrigerated container on a regular basis. Use marine-grade paint to protect the container from rust and keep it in perfect condition. It is also essential to repair minor dents that may affect the integrity of seals.
